The State of AI in Credit.
Learnings and insights from conversations with 30+ Australian credit funds.
2026 Report10 min read
Methodology.
- Participants
- MDs, analysts, CIOs and more
- Size range
- Approximately A$100m to over A$50bn FUM
- Method
- Qualitative conversations, not a survey
The primary evidence used to form this report were conversations with over 30 Australian credit funds. We spoke with managing directors, analysts, CIOs and more at firms ranging from approximately A$100 million to over A$50 billion in FUM.
These conversations are supplemented by:
- Current job advertisements and company careers page research
- ASX filings, results presentations and investor materials where relevant
- ASIC and APRA publications
- General AI and finance news
This is our first edition of the State of AI in Australian Private Credit and we aim to release a version of this report biannually. AI capability is changing quickly, so this is a point-in-time picture rather than a settled maturity ranking. In future volumes of our report we aim to include quantitative surveys to support our more qualitative interviews.
Taking a step back, the broader state of private credit in Australia.
Australian private credit has transformed from a niche funding source to an estimated A$230 billion market in 2025 (the regulators are not actually sure what the size of the market is today). EY-Parthenon estimates it compounded at 21% a year from 2015 to 2025. This growth rate is nearly 4 times the growth rate of commercial bank lending (EY-Parthenon’s 2025 Australian Private Debt Market Overview).
“We are aware of more than 240 private credit managers operating funds in Australia, with over 375 open-ended funds in market,” he said. “Around 70 per cent are focused on real estate rather than broader corporate lending.
Dugald Higgins, Head of Income Research at Zenith Group, quoted in The Australian.
For funds, competition is becoming more intense. A few basis points can be the difference between winning a deal and losing it.
“Fund X is seen as Fund Y’s biggest competitive threat: larger and cheaper, putting pressure on our pricing advantage.
Analyst, A$2 billion FUM property fund
However the response cannot simply be to cut cost. ASIC has begun to turn its attention to the market making poor private credit practices an enforcement priority (ASIC’s 2026 enforcement priorities). ASIC’s concern has been around (ASIC’s June 2026 private credit update):
- credit deterioration,
- liquidity buffers,
- concentration-risk management,
- valuations that may lag economic reality
Funds are trying to do two things at once: run a leaner operating model and maintain and control risk.
What funds want from AI.
Therefore the opportunities funds described come back to two outcomes:
- Less manual work. Remove the repetitive assembly, checking and reformatting that absorbs analyst time.
- More visibility and control. Give the fund a clearer view of what is happening, with source material, decisions and approvals easy to find and review.
Notably there was no real focus on utilising AI to generate alpha i.e. actions that give the funds a competitive advantage across risk mitigation or origination opportunities.
Automation of tedious workflows
Across the conversations, funds did not question the quality of their people. They questioned how their best people’s time was being allocated.
Their best analysts are often still assembling, checking and formatting information, often paper shuffling or moving sections around an excel or powerpoint. That work can be automated allowing the team to either:
- Focus on revenue generating work (meeting with prospective borrowers)
- Revenue protecting work (meeting and understanding existing borrowers)
- Handle larger volume of work (which naturally some funds hope for)
Below are the four workflows funds raised most often as opportunities for automation.
1. Loan monitoring and covenants
This was the clearest opportunity from our conversations. Monitoring is recurring, document-heavy and closely tied to a fund’s control environment. This is a particular area of focus for funds with:
- Broader landscape of high profile fund deterioration
- ASIC crackdown on valuations, of which loan monitoring is closely linked
- Growing funds looking to raise funds from institutional capital
Loan monitoring pulls together borrower reporting, covenant definitions, prior credit decisions, financial models and the portfolio manager’s current view.
“Monitoring is the current #1 time sink. A huge amount of resources is getting monitoring up to speed.
CEO, ~$300M FUM Corporate Fund
This fund reported that each analyst spent roughly one business day per loan on a monthly monitoring cycle. With six to eight loans each, that equals approximately six to eight analyst-days a month, or roughly 30-40% of a 20-business-day month. This is a fund-reported baseline, not an independently audited measure.
The opportunity for monitoring is to collect the right inputs, at the right time, show the source material, flag what has changed and give the responsible analyst a better starting point for review. With that in place, the analysis can go deeper, drawing in more data and surfacing patterns across the book that would otherwise not be visible.
2. Deal intake and origination triage
“The high volume of inbound deals is difficult to triage systematically.
Director, ~$600M FUM Corporate Lending Fund
This is a useful early workflow to automate because:
- It is bounded with a clear start and stop
- There are often clear criteria to quickly screen deals in and out for a team member to pick up and analyse
- Highly repetitive process occurring in some funds daily
- For funds focused on growing, origination is a bottleneck for growth
- It’s generally low risk
3. Credit papers and IC preparation
“Our analysts spend too much time on formatting. How do we get this pitch deck to look like this in three minutes? So the team can spend their brain power on thinking through the deal
Head of Private Credit, ~$5 billion FUM, part of larger asset group
“It takes two days for us to write an IC paper
Head of Property, ~$3 billion FUM, real estate and healthcare credit fund
A well automated IC process gives the analyst a stronger starting point and should be easier to trace and review. It should not create a polished recommendation that masks thin evidence.
We have seen interest in two uses:
- Turning a fund’s own prior papers into a structured reference set,
- Testing a new IC paper through defined reviewer personas
Both are well suited to AI systems, which can surface precedent, gaps and questions.
4. Valuations, reconciliations and investor reporting
These are often the largest manual blocks from our research.
“It takes a week full time for each fund… We’d like to be communicating with our investors more, and just be a bit more systematic about that.
Analyst, ~$200M Boutique credit firm
Funds will often have internal or offshore teams to handle these operational processes. They are also more sensitive. A wrong valuation, a missed reconciliation item or an unsupported investor statement carries consequences far beyond a poor internal summary. These are not first-wave deployments.
For a fund at the start of its adoption curve, the sensible scope is speeding up preparation.
Seeing the fund as it is now.
Another large opportunity is simply being able to see the fund as it is now.
At one fund, portfolio reporting draws on around 15 separate touchpoints and is assembled manually each month. Its directors want one view of the book, showing what is on the watch list, what is expiring and where action is needed, without reviewing 75 to 100 loans one by one.
This is more than a reporting problem. To understand the current state of the fund, senior leaders often have to reconstruct the answer across multiple sources and people. When an analyst moves on, the fund can lose the history, judgement and exceptions that person has accumulated around a deal. The next person has to rebuild it from what they can find…
AI creates two opportunities:
- Build shared fund context. Capture important information, decisions and rationale from everyday work, then retain it in the fund’s shared context rather than in one person’s inbox, files or memory.
- Give each senior leader a realtime view of the information they care most about.
- An analyst should see the information and next steps relevant to their deals.
- A director should see the state of the book, the highest-priority risks and the actions that need attention
What are credit funds doing about this?
Every fund we spoke to was ‘doing something’ about AI. This appetite showed up in different forms.
Buying individual accounts directly
People want to test the tools before a formal program exists
Running enterprise trials or group rollouts
Large organisations see the strategic case, even when use is uneven
Using multiple models in parallel
Teams are actively comparing capability rather than waiting for a settled market (often IT approved vs shadow IT)
Building small internal tools
The most motivated users are already turning work into workflows
Replacing or upgrading a core platform
Managers see data and systems as the limiting factor, not just the model
Many of the funds we spoke with are still at the start of their AI journey.
“Self-taught and ad hoc rather than systematically implemented.
MD of originations, ~$200M FUM corporate fund
“Beginning of their AI adoption journey with no coordinated strategy currently in place.
COO, ~$750M Property Fund
“Our adoption’s been slow.
Director of Investments, $2 billion FUM, part of larger asset group
These quotes show a market in motion. Tools are already in the hands of analysts, investment teams and operations staff. Formal capability has not caught up.
The question is not whether credit funds use AI. They already do. The question is whether the firm is getting value out of it…
So, is anyone getting real value yet? No, not really.
The demand for adoption is there, but the reality post implementation is very different. It starts with the fund struggling to articulate what it actually wants the outcome to be. Big ideas, no clear KPIs, and almost nothing invested in the execution.
The technology is genuinely revolutionary but that changes nothing when there is no genuine investment in change management, and clear metrics of what successful AI adoption looks like.
Where funds are getting stuck.
While each fund we spoke to had many hopes, aspirations, and dreams for what AI could do, not a single fund was happy with their progress. Below we list the most common failure points we observed from the funds we spoke to.
1. Poorly selected owner
You need someone (or even a team) accountable to make change happen. This person needs to have the time, focus, skill and authority to make things happen. We saw time and time again those selected to lead the fund’s AI transformation were set up to fail… or they did not exist…
“They gave me the responsibility to implement AI as I’m the young guy in the team.
Analyst, $200M corporate lender
“Whilst I am the most knowledgable on AI I appreciate that it needs to be someone that’s not me. I am already slammed
Director Private Investments, $300M NBFI lender
The below table highlights common patterns with AI ownership and common risks
Emerging boutique
An analyst
The work remains siloed and dependent on one person often without authority to make true change
Small to mid-sized manager
A senior leader is put in charge of AI
The leader has an existing job which demands most of their attention, no change occurs
Larger organisation
IT or transformation teams lead the work
The use case disappears into an IT queue or a broad platform rollout
Organisation with a formal AI team (very rare)
A dedicated team has budget, authority and operating responsibility
Formalisation is mistaken for evidence that a credit workflow has changed
We tested whether the market is beginning to hire for this role or AI skill set broadly. The data suggests not really and that’s not necessarily a bad thing.
On 17 August 2026, we reviewed live roles on Seek.com.au for credit funds. There were 86 live Credit roles and 87 Funds Management roles. We found no dedicated AI role advertised by an Australian private-credit fund manager. Nor was AI mentioned in the skillsets for any of these roles.
Despite this, there are some early signs that the largest managers are beginning to formalise the capability. Qualitas appointed a Chief AI Transformation Officer in 2025. While Balmain has an AI Adoption and Enablement Lead. These are not yet standard roles across the market. And even alone are not enough to see meaningful change across the organisation.
AI is not just a new technology, it’s a new way to do work. An expert in AI who knows how to use the tools won’t lead to organisation wide adoption. Instead you need tools that are capable of bridging the gap between the old and new ways.
For example, accountants did not adopt Excel because someone was hired who understood spreadsheets. They adopted it because it looked similar to the manual tooling they already used. Nobody had to learn a new way to think and the tool met them inside the job they already knew. Consequently a new way of working followed.
What this blocker contains: time, ownership, mandate, budget and accountability.
What it looks like in practice: a capable analyst building after hours; a director maintaining the tools; or a central programme that is not owned by the credit team.
2. Data is a blocker, but not in the way most think
Across the research set, origination data, post-settlement financials and supporting documents sat in separate systems. Teams rely on manual exports and reconciliation to join them, and some are part-way through migrations off legacy infrastructure. The data exists. Bringing it into a current, controlled view of a live position is the hard part. Ultimately, poorly accessible and fractured data will lead to poor quality AI output.
Almost every fund accurately identifies this problem, but they treat it as being more of a problem than it is in reality. And often it is the perception of the size of the problem that blocks any immediate progress.
The instinct is to clean everything first, move it all into one place, and only then start. That project rarely finishes, and it is not what the technology needs.
Think of it as a library rather than a data lake. You do not need every book rewritten, or even read. You need to know what is on each shelf, which edition is the current one, and where to send someone looking for a particular thing. A good catalogue makes the collection usable. Rewriting the collection does not.
The version problem is the real one. Nine drafts of the same IC memo sit in the folder and nothing in the file tells you which one went to committee. AI will confidently answer from the wrong one. Deciding which is authoritative, and keeping that true as new drafts land, is the work.
So the starting point is not cleaning all source data. It is mapping what exists, marking what is authoritative, and putting a process around keeping that map current.
The AI application that sits on top of that data is the value and can be realised much quicker than people think.
What this blocker contains: integration, data quality, systems age, security, access control, approvals and auditability.
What it looks like in practice: manual exports between systems; a tool that cannot access internal records; a useful experiment that cannot pass security review; or a platform replacement that keeps the organisation in transition.
3. IT and security slow deployment
Many funds described IT, security and management approval as a barrier to AI deployment.
“We are very concerned about governance, privacy and data security given our client base.
IT team of an approximately A$1 billion property fund
“Our AI rollout was deprioritised behind the organisation’s IT integration programme.
MD, portfolio monitoring at a multi-billion-dollar property fund
“We were only allowed Copilot. You already have a hand behind your back.
Analyst, A$2 billion property fund
When approval feels slow or opaque, analysts abandon useful ideas or experiment outside approved processes (both were observed). One outcome leaves the fund unable to learn and at risk of losing good people. The other creates ungoverned use of sensitive information. The practical response is to involve IT and security early around a specific workflow and make the business case clear.
What this blocker contains: data classification and privacy, access permissions, vendor risk, data residency and retention, model-training terms, audit trails and incident response.
What it looks like in practice: a team cannot use a promising tool because it is unclear where client data is stored; an experiment stalls in a lengthy vendor-security review; analysts rely on consumer tools because no approved alternative exists; or access is granted without clear permissions, monitoring or accountability.
4. Adoption stalls between the individual and the organisation
Being good at AI yourself is not the same as your organisation being good at AI. We see three levels of AI fluency:
- Personal fluency: an individual knows how to use AI well in their own work.
- Team fluency: people share practical ways of using it, know when to trust it, and can hand work between each other.
- Organisational fluency: a workflow is owned, governed, measured and maintained. It works even when the original power user is busy or leaves.
Some funds in this research show personal AI fluency. Fewer have translated it into shared team practice. We spoke with only one fund taking deliberate steps towards organisation-wide capability.
That is why licences alone do not create adoption. A fund can buy access to a tool and still work exactly as before. It is not principally a technology problem. It is a people-and-process problem. Often these change management skills do not exist internally in the fund.
What this blocker contains: trust, workflow design, training, clear expectations, shared review, measurement, maintenance and human accountability.
What it looks like in practice: a few power users moving ahead of the team; a pilot that never becomes part of the process; or a high-performing workflow that depends on one person to keep it alive.
How to overcome these blockers.
Our research points to six practical conditions that turn AI hopes and dreams into reality.
A bounded first use case
Start with a workflow that has a clear start and a clear end, so you can measure what changed. Turning a broker email into a logged deal record, or drafting a monitoring update from approved material. If you cannot say where it begins and where it finishes, you cannot prove the impact.
A broad ambition to “implement AI” that is difficult to approve, measure or sustain.
A clear owner with the right resources
One person is accountable for getting the first use case live, with the authority, skills and time to change how the work is done. This is for one process. Organisation-wide adoption is the same thing done many times over.
A junior champion has momentum but cannot change the process, is blocked by access, or a senior sponsor has authority but no capacity.
Early involvement from IT, security, compliance and risk
Define the users, information, permissions, review steps and fallback process before building. Bring these teams in around a specific workflow, not a general request for AI.
A useful prototype stalls when it needs access to real data or security approval.
A baseline and review loop
Appreciate that the initial version won’t be perfect. A fund changes and evolves and there must be an inbuilt way to capture feedback and improve.
Assuming once an AI process is live the work has finished. Ensure there is an owner or process for what happens after…
Data is not a barrier, just get started
Waiting for everything to be perfect means you will never start. Messy data may not be a problem. Map out where it is and see what AI can do with it then iterate.
Assuming that because your data is messy that the AI will fail… just start and see if your assumptions are true blockers. (AI can handle your messy data)

Where to from here?
We believe the next step for AI in credit is a shift from individual use to fund-level change in how work gets done. Other regulated industries are already moving beyond individual experimentation…
Financial services is moving from pilots to operating systems
Large financial institutions show what operational AI looks like once the data, governance and internal capability exist.
- CBA reported about A$200 million in measured gross AI benefit in FY26, with roughly 80 per cent of staff actively using enterprise AI tools.
- Suncorp reported 3,900 staff-built agents.
- IAG has flagged about A$200 million of AI and AI-enablement investment for FY27, alongside more than 600 internal activators and over 90 published agents.
Specialist operating systems are emerging in adjacent professions
We are also seeing organisational AI capability be productised in law and banking. Law has moved beyond generic chat tools towards products that connect professional context, review and workflow. Currently there are two leading AI law products, Harvey and Legora. Both position themselves as domain-specific AI for legal and professional services, including contract analysis, diligence, compliance and litigation workflows.
Investment banking has comparable specialist platforms in Rogo and Hebbia. Both connect internal and external financial data with agents designed to produce work across PowerPoint, Excel and Word.
Private credit has the same ingredients: proprietary information, recurring documents, human accountability, a defined decision process and a need for source-level confidence. It has not yet developed the same operating layer.
